  • Abstract
    This paper discusses TVA´s practices in the design of ac auxiliary power distribution systems of large thermal generating plants. Its scope is limited to the primary portions of the system, including the station service transformers which step down the main generator voltage or switchyard voltage, and the switchgear and buses which distribute power from the secondaries of these transformers. Single-line diagrams of one fossil and two nuclear plants are presented. The change from systems designed with common startup and emergency supplies to a system which provides startup power from the main transformer with independent alternate offsite power sources is discussed.
